Robert Smith

Vice President Innovation Product Development at Lemnature AquaFarms

Robert Smith has a diverse work experience spanning over several decades. Robert began their career as a Postdoctoral Fellow at the University of Missouri-Columbia in 1990. Robert then worked as a Research Assistant Professor at Rutgers University AgBiotech Center from 1995 to 1997. Following this, they held the position of Project Leader at Dekalb Genetics from 1997 to 1999. In 1999, they joined PhycoGen Inc as the Director of Research & Development. Robert then went on to work at Global Protein Products Inc. as the VP of Research & Development from 2003 to 2007. From 2007 to 2010, they served as the Director of Business Development at HerbalScience Group. In 2012, they joined RiceBran Technologies (formerly NutraCea) as the Senior Vice President of Business Development, a role they held until December 2018. During their time at RiceBran Technologies, they also served as the CEO from September 2016 to September 2018. In 2019, they became the Principal at Sheldon Botanicals LLC. Currently, they are the Vice President of Innovation & Product Development at Lemnature AquaFarms, starting from March 2021.

Robert Smith holds a PhD in Molecular Genetics and Cell Biology from the University of Chicago. Prior to this, they earned a Bachelor of Arts degree in Biology from the same institution.
